Democracy Camp takes the Square

Parliament Square, London. Sat 18 Oct 2014

 

 
 George Barda speaks
     
 'Frack Free Nana of "Nanashire"' listening to the speeches

 

 And a woman with rainbow peace flag poses for me in front of Big Ben

 

 Other protesters watch from outside the area which is now marked out by yellow flags as a 'Safe Space'

 More police arriving and form up in small blocks around the square, waiting for the order to charge

 

 While 'Democracy' continues in the centre of the square

 
 
More police  

Some of the protesters remain on the pavement - the grass is a little muddy for wheelchairs, though some go on it 

Environmental campaigner Donnachadh McCarthy speaking 

Yet more police arrive and are obviously keen to go into action 

The woman with the peace flag again 

'Protesting Feels Better than Votin' 

Vanessa speaking about the safe spaces and other admin for Democracy camp
